About the event
Set in Haarlem, Holland, The Watchmaker’s Daughter follows the Ten Boom family as they turn their century-old watch shop into a sanctuary for Jewish neighbors fleeing Nazi persecution.
As danger intensifies, the family builds a hidden room in their home and becomes part of an underground resistance network. When betrayal leads to arrest and imprisonment, Corrie and her sister Betsie must confront unimaginable loss inside Ravensbrück concentration camp.
In the barracks of suffering, Betsie declares a radical truth: love is stronger than hate. Forgiveness is the final battle.
More than a story of survival, this musical invites audiences into a legacy of courageous obedience and enduring hope—reminding us that there is no darkness beyond the reach of God’s light.
